(1) StressesbeyondthoselistedunderAbsoluteMaximumRatingsmaycausepermanentdamagetothedevice.Thesearestressratings
only,whichdonotimplyfunctionaloperationofthedeviceattheseoranyotherconditionsbeyondthoseindicatedunderRecommended
OperatingConditions.Exposuretoabsolute-maximum-ratedconditionsforextendedperiodsmayaffectdevicereliability.

(1) CScanbetiedlowpermanentlyincasetheserialbusisnotsharedwithanyotherdevice.
(2) HoldingSCLKlowlongerthan28msresetstheSPIinterface.
